The critical value for the given confidence level, c = 0.90 and n = 21 is [tex]t_c=1.725[/tex].
The critical value is calculated as follows:
It is given that,
confidence level c = 0.90
sample size n = 21
Then,
degree of freedom,
(d.f) = n - 1 = 21 - 1 = 20
So, from the t-distribution table,
at d.f = 20 and the confidence level 0.90, the critical value is 1.725.
I.e., [tex]t_c[/tex] = 1.725
For this, α = (1 - 0.90)/2 = 0.05
